Overview
The Technology Operations & Delivery R&D team is looking for a Principle TPM to drive our customer experience strategy forward by consistently innovating and problem-solving. The ideal candidate will oversee complex projects in a dynamic, fast-paced environment. The TPM will be responsible for driving internal or cross-functional teams, ensuring seamless project execution, and delivering results under changing circumstances. This is an opportunity to work on a diverse range of projects and make a significant impact on the organization’s success.
Role
• The principle TPM will play a critical role in planning and executing the delivery of technical vision and roadmap, unlocking synergies across our platforms, data assets and business units.
• The TPM will act as a central point of coordination for infrastructure and cloud capabilities for various R&D teams distributed across around the globe to drive standardization, alignment across initiatives, and ensure global program governance best practices.
• Continuously work on finding ways to optimize manual processes with a lens of automation and help improve program execution in the new AI native world.
• Act as the program liaison, provide specific direction for product development initiatives, supporting teams to ensure that all program engagements meet timelines and scope expectations.
• Develop and manage flexible project plans, adapting to shifting business priorities and requirements.
• Drive execution of strategic initiatives through successful delivery by organizing a group of related technology projects or activities across multiple teams, aligning dependent organizations to ensure coordinated delivery.
• Identify and remove barriers, finding the path forward in challenging situations to ensure timely and effective project completion
• Effectively monitor, control, and report on project execution, adapt communication strategies to fit the urgency and complexity of different projects providing accurate status updates to executive stakeholders at appropriate intervals.
• Recognize complexity and create predictable delivery paths for large and/or complex efforts, while measurably improving, streamlining, and eliminating excess processes.
• Manage relationships with vendors including SOW creation, amendments, termination, resource onboarding, financial tracking.
